THE CHARTERED INSTITUTE OF TAXATION OF NIGERIA, promotes professional ethics in tax, efficiency in tax administration and practices in Nigeria; only registered members may practice taxation in Nigeria

INVITATION TO CITN MEMBERS: REGISTER NOW FOR THE NATIONAL TAX FORUM 2026

The Chartered Institute of Taxation of Nigeria (CITN) is pleased to draw the attention of all members to the National Tax Forum 2026, a high-level tax discourse bringing together distinguished policymakers, tax administrators, business leaders, academics, regulators and industry experts to examine critical issues shaping Nigeria's evolving tax landscape.

Theme:
"Nigeria's New Tax Era: Implications for Businesses, the Informal Sector and Revenue Performance."

Date: 2nd – 3rd July 2026

Venue: J.F. Ade Ajayi Auditorium, University of Lagos (UNILAG)

Attendance: FREE (Registration is however Mandatory)

Participants will have the unique opportunity to:
- Gain first-hand insights into Nigeria's new tax policy direction and reform initiatives.

- Engage with leading experts and key stakeholders in the tax ecosystem.
- Network with professionals, regulators, business leaders and policymakers.

- Explore the implications of current reforms for tax practice, compliance, and business operations.

2026 National Tax Awareness Day: Driving Progress Through Compliance

National development relies heavily on a robust, transparent, and compliant tax system. The Chartered Institute of Taxation of Nigeria (CITN) invites the public, business owners, and professionals to the 2026 National Tax Awareness Day.

This year, all forty-nine CITN districts are uniting for a massive nationwide sensitisation campaign designed to bridge the gap between tax authorities and citizens.

Event Details
Date: 25th June, 2026

Theme: Tax Awareness for National Growth: Reform, Compliance & Shared Prosperity

Chief Host: Mr. Innocent C. Ohagwa, FCTI (17th President/Chairman of Council, CITN)

Host: Titilayo Eni-Itan Fowokan, mni, Ph.D., FCTI (Chairman, Joint District Societies)

*What to Expect Across the Nation*
The campaign will feature a variety of impactful activities aimed at fostering economic education and engagement:
*Tax Walk:* Public awareness marches across districts.

*Radio Shows:* Live discussions with tax experts answering critical questions.

*Tax Clinics:* Dedicated spaces to get professional advice on your tax concerns.

*Tax Quiz & Debates:* Engaging educational competitions for students and professionals.

*SME & Business Sensitisation:* Targeted guidance to help small and medium enterprises understand and simplify tax obligations.

*Public Lectures & Seminars:* Deep dives into fiscal policies and economic reforms.

Economic progress is a collective responsibility. Proper taxation ensures better infrastructure, sustainable development, and long-term economic stability for everyone. Join the movement, visit the tax clinics, and participate in the conversations happening within your district.
